Dear "Muralitharan Perumal", In message <49f5b80b.2090...@pace.com> you wrote: > > I just wanted to do some testing on ethernet driver in Uboot. I have a
You may want to look into the Ethenret related POST code in U-Boot. > small program that will send a binary file through ethernet. But I don't > have any clue on how to receive those packets in U-boot. I mean what are > the API's to be used. It will be helpful if you could tell me how to do > that in U-boot. Why don't you just perform a TFTP and/or NFS file transfer? You can then check the file integrity for example using some checksumming - if you transfer a mkimage created image, this even comes for free. > Another thing is My target board is connected to eth1 of my host and i > am able to ping the host from target saying it's alive. But i am not > able to ping the target from the host. Does it mean, the target is > restricted to send icmp responses back to host? Please read the doc. U-Boot does not reply to OCMP packets. > This E-mail and any attachments hereto are strictly confidential and intended > solely for the addressee.
